メインコンテンツ

このページは機械翻訳を使用して翻訳されました。最新版の英語を参照するには、ここをクリックします。

mdfAddChannelGroupMetadata

チャネルグループとチャネルメタデータを timetable に追加する

R2022a 以降

説明

TTout = mdfAddChannelGroupMetadata(TTin) は、デフォルトまたは推測されたチャネル グループとチャネル メタデータを入力 timetable に追加し、結果の timetable を返します。存在し値を持つカスタム プロパティについては、変更は行われません。この関数は、不足しているカスタム プロパティを追加し、設定されていないプロパティを既定値または派生値に設定します。チャネル グループ メタデータは、ChannelGroup* で始まるカスタム プロパティとして追加されます。チャネル メタデータは、Channel* で始まるカスタム プロパティとして追加され、変数ごとに要素があります。

入力と出力に同じ timetable を使用できます。

すべて折りたたむ

MDF データの既存の timetable を変更して、カスタム プロパティ メタデータを追加します。

既存の timetable のプロパティを調べます。

TTin.Properties
ans = 

  TimetableProperties with properties:

             Description: '10 ms'
                UserData: []
          DimensionNames: {'Time'  'Variables'}
           VariableNames: {1×74 cell}
    VariableDescriptions: {1×74 cell}
           VariableUnits: {1×74 cell}
      VariableContinuity: []
                RowTimes: [1993×1 duration]
               StartTime: 0.00082554 sec
              SampleRate: 100.0000
                TimeStep: 0.01 sec
        CustomProperties: No custom properties are set.

メタデータを追加し、結果のプロパティを調べて比較します。

TTout = mdfAddChannelGroupMetadata(TTin);
TTout.Properties.CustomProperties
ans = 

CustomProperties with properties:

    ChannelGroupAcquisitionName: ""
            ChannelGroupComment: ""
         ChannelGroupSourceInfo: [1×1 struct]
             ChannelDisplayName: [""    ""    ""    ""    ""    ""    ""    ""    ""    ""    …    ]
                 ChannelComment: [""    ""    ""    ""    ""    ""    ""    ""    ""    ""    …    ]
                    ChannelUnit: [""    ""    ""    ""    ""    ""    ""    ""    ""    ""    …    ]
                    ChannelType: [FixedLength    FixedLength    FixedLength    FixedLength    …    ]
                ChannelDataType: [IntegerUnsignedLittleEndian    IntegerUnsignedLittleEndian    …    ]
                 ChannelNumBits: [8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 8 … ]
           ChannelComponentType: [None    None    None    None    None    None    None    None    …    ]
         ChannelCompositionType: [None    None    None    None    None    None    None    None    …    ]
              ChannelSourceInfo: [1×74 struct]
              ChannelReadOption: [Missing    Missing    Missing    Missing    Missing    …    ]

入力引数

すべて折りたたむ

チャネル グループおよびチャネル メタデータの有無にかかわらず、MDF データの timetable を入力します。

データ型: timetable

出力引数

すべて折りたたむ

チャネル グループとチャネル メタデータのカスタム プロパティを使用して、MDF データの timetable を出力します。

バージョン履歴

R2022a で導入

参考

関数